Hi Mohamed, sorry, I have not fully documented the procedure yet. I've put some notes below doug
1. To start, run gtmseg --s subject This will take a couple of hours and produces some files needed for GTM PVC (which is used for GTM, MG, RBV). 2. You'd then register the PET to the anatomical with bbregister (with --t2 weighting). Make sure to save the output as an LTA (--lta). I usually use the mean TAC as the input. You can do this in parallel with #1. 3. You'd then run mri_gtmpvc, something like mri_gtmpvc --i tac.nii.gz --psf PSF --auto-mask PSF+2 .01 --seg gtmseg.mgz --reg reg.lta --default-seg-merge --mgx .01 --o gtmpvc.output --km-hb 11 12 13 50 51 52 --km-ref 8 47 --no-rescale PSF is the point-spread FWHM of the scanner; reg.lta is the registration from #2. --km-hb specifies the highbinding region for MRTM2. --km-ref specifies the reference region. --mgx specifies to output a muller-gartner map (not necessary for GTM ROI analysis). 4. For the GTM (ROI) MRTM1 KM analysis, you would then run mri_glmfit --y km.hb.tac.nii.gz --mrtm1 km.ref.tac.dat time.dat --o mrtm1 --no-est-fwhm --nii.gz where time.dat is a text file withe acquisition time of each time point in the tac. 5. For the MRTM2 analysis set k2p = `cat mrtm1/k2prime.dat` mri_glmfit --y km.hb.tac.nii.gz --mrtm2 km.ref.tac.dat time.dat $k2p --o mrtm1 --no-est-fwhm --nii.gz If you want to run a voxel-wise analysis, then you can use the mgx volume as input (--y).
